Comprehending Senior Citizen Abuse: Types and interpretations



Elder abuse includes a series of unsafe actions routed towards older grownups, often resulting in physical, psychological, or financial harm (Nursing Home Abuse). This abuse can materialize in a number of kinds, consisting of physical misuse, which involves inflicting physical injury, and psychological abuse, characterized by mental torture and control. Overlook, an additional considerable type, takes place when caregivers stop working to provide required care, causing damage in the elder's health and wellness or health. Financial exploitation involves the unauthorized use an older's possessions or funds, usually perpetrated by those in relied on settings. Additionally, sex-related misuse, although less regularly reported, represents a severe violation of a senior's self-respect. Comprehending these meanings and kinds is crucial for recognizing the indicators of older misuse and ensuring the safety and security and rights of older grownups. Awareness and education about these different types can encourage communities to intervene and support those in vulnerable situations successfully




Legal Structure: Federal and State Rule



While numerous kinds of elder misuse are acknowledged, the lawful structure resolving these concerns is important for shielding older adults. At the government level, laws such as the Senior Justice Act develop provisions to react and protect against to elder abuse, disregard, and exploitation. This act gives funding for study, training, and resources targeted at improving the security of susceptible senior citizens.


State laws also play a crucial role, as each state has its own statutes defining senior misuse and laying out enforcement devices. These laws commonly incorporate a range of misuses, consisting of physical, psychological, monetary, and overlook. Furthermore, some states have actually executed specific older misuse systems within police to concentrate on these cases.


With each other, government and state regulations develop a comprehensive framework created to fight senior misuse, making sure that older adults receive the security and assistance they require in their areas.

Legal Consequences for Non-Reporting



Failing to abide by obligatory coverage demands can lead to substantial lawful repercussions for specialists tasked with securing susceptible grownups. Experts such as doctor, social workers, and legislation enforcement officials are legally obligated to report thought cases of older misuse. Failure to do so might lead to civil obligations, consisting of fines or claims. In some jurisdictions, non-reporting can bring about criminal fees, possibly causing misdemeanor or felony sentences. Additionally, experts might encounter corrective actions from licensing boards, consisting of suspension or abrogation of their licenses. These lawful repercussions underscore the significance of adhering to reporting laws, which are developed to safeguard susceptible populaces and assure that instances of senior abuse are addressed quickly and appropriately.

Signs and Signs of Senior Citizen Misuse



Recognizing the signs and signs of older misuse is essential for guarding vulnerable people. Senior misuse can show up in numerous kinds, consisting of physical, emotional, monetary, and forget. Physical indicators might consist of unexplained contusions, fractures, or indicators of restraint. Psychological misuse commonly provides as withdrawal, terror, or abrupt adjustments in habits. Sufferers might display signs of anxiety, complication, or anxiousness.


Financial misuse may be indicated by abrupt modifications in monetary standing or missing out on belongings, while forget can be determined with bad health, lack of nutrition, or hazardous living problems. It is necessary to keep in mind that these indicators can overlap, and one sign alone might not indicate misuse. Observing numerous symptoms in combination can give a clearer image. Caregivers and family members need to remain alert and positive in identifying these indications to guarantee the well-being of older grownups and promote prompt treatment when necessary.

Civil Suits for Problems



Elder abuse sufferers frequently look for justice via civil suits, which provide an important lawful remedy for those damaged by oversight or deliberate misbehavior. These claims allow sufferers or their family members to sue for physical, psychological, or financial injury withstood as a result of the actions of caretakers, nursing homes, or other accountable parties. Typical claims in these situations consist of neglect, intentional infliction of emotional distress, and breach of fiduciary task. Victims can look for countervailing damages to cover clinical expenses, pain and suffering, and compensatory damages aimed at see page discouraging future transgression. Civil claims not just provide monetary relief but additionally offer to hold abusers liable, consequently contributing to more comprehensive societal modifications in the therapy of at risk older populaces.


Criminal Prosecution Options



A significant variety of elder abuse instances may also cause criminal prosecution, giving an additional avenue for justice past civil treatments. District attorneys can pursue charges for different offenses, consisting of fraud, assault, or overlook, depending on the particular scenarios of the abuse. Prosecution serves not only to penalize culprits yet also to discourage further misuse and shield vulnerable individuals. The lawful criteria for criminal situations differ from civil instances, typically needing a greater problem of evidence, usually "beyond a sensible question." Victims or their advocates may work together with police to report occurrences, ensuring that the legal system holds wrongdoers accountable. Overall, prosecution is an important device in the battle against senior misuse, reinforcing societal standards versus such crimes.

The Role of Guardianship in Protecting Seniors



Guardianship plays a necessary role in guarding the health of elders, particularly when they are unable to make enlightened decisions concerning their care and financial resources. This legal arrangement assigns an accountable person or entity to supervise the financial and personal affairs of an incapacitated elderly. Guardianship is specifically important in cases where elders are susceptible to exploitation, overlook, or abuse, as it provides a safety framework guaranteeing their civil liberties and demands are focused on.


The responsibilities of a guardian consist of making health care decisions, managing residential property, and ensuring that the elderly's living conditions are safe and encouraging. Furthermore, guardians are required to abide by legal standards and record routinely to the court, advertising accountability and openness. By promoting oversight, guardianship works as a necessary system to secure seniors, cultivating their self-respect and boosting their top quality of life in potentially hazardous situations.
